
At a meeting of the Sports Committee, First Deputy Finance Minister Giorgi Kakauridze presented the Annual Report on the Execution of Georgia’s 2025 State Budget.
“Additional funding was allocated to the Ministry of Sports from the state budget at the end of 2025. As a result of effective management, the Ministry was able to execute its budget at 100.3%”, - the First Deputy Minister stated.
The presenter provided a detailed overview of the economic, revenue, and fiscal parameters of the country’s main financial document for 2025. According to him, the economy concluded the year with 7.5% growth, exceeding the planned rate of 6%. The budget deficit had been projected at 2.5%, but amounted to only 1.4% by the end of the year.
“Compared to 2024, foreign trade turnover increased by 10.3% in 2025, while foreign direct investment grew by 7.6%. The upward trend in tourism revenues continued, reaching USD 4.69 billion, which is 6% higher than the 2024 figure. Money transfers also increased by 8.2% compared to the previous year, totaling USD 3.23 billion”, - Giorgi Kakauridze noted.
He further stated that in 2025, the revenue component of the state budget was fulfilled at 100.7%, amounting to GEL 23.816 billion, while expenditures totaled GEL 22.854 billion.
Discussion of the report continued in a question-and-answer format during the committee session.
The Sports Committee positively assessed the Annual Report on the Execution of the 2025 State Budget and took note of it.
